Bulgaria - Total Primary Education Pupil-Teacher Ratio

Since 2009, Bulgaria Total Primary Education Pupil-Teacher Ratio was up 0.5% year on year. In 2014, the country was number 58 comparing other countries in Total Primary Education Pupil-Teacher Ratio with 17.73 Persons. Bulgaria is overtaken by Barbados, which was ranked number 57 at 18.49 Persons and is followed by Peru with 17.66 Persons. Malawi, Rwanda and Mozambique resp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Ecuador witnessed the best average annual growth at +7.1% per year, while Honduras was the worst growing country at -16.6% per year.
